Examine the Water Meter



Every home has a water meter. Inspecting it is a guaranteed manner in which helps you discover leakages. For starters, switch off all the water resources. Guarantee nobody will flush, utilize the faucet, shower, run the washing equipment or dish washer. From there, most likely to the meter and watch if it will certainly transform. Considering that nobody is using it, there ought to be no motions. If it moves, that indicates a fast-moving leakage. Similarly, if you find no changes, wait an hour or two and also inspect back again. This means you may have a slow leakage that could also be below ground.

WARNING SIGNS OF WATER LEAKAGE BEHIND THE WALL

 

PERSISTENT MUSTY ODORS

 

As water slowly drips from a leaky pipe inside the wall, flooring and sheetrock stay damp and develop an odor similar to wet cardboard. It generates a musty smell that can help you find hidden leaks.



 

MOLD IN UNUSUAL AREAS

 

Mold usually grows in wet areas like kitchens, baths and laundry rooms. If you spot the stuff on walls or baseboards in other rooms of the house, it’s a good indicator of undetected water leaks.



 

STAINS THAT GROW

 

When mold thrives around a leaky pipe, it sometimes takes hold on the inside surface of the affected wall. A growing stain on otherwise clean sheetrock is often your sign of a hidden plumbing problem.



 

PEELING OR BUBBLING WALLPAPER / PAINT

 

This clue is easy to miss in rooms that don’t get much use. When you see wallpaper separating along seams or paint bubbling or flaking off the wall, blame sheetrock that stays wet because of an undetected leak.



 

BUCKLED CEILINGS AND STAINED FLOORS

 

If ceilings or floors in bathrooms, kitchens or laundry areas develop structural problems, don’t rule out constant damp inside the walls. Wet sheetrock can affect adjacent framing, flooring and ceilings.
